In October 2025 the FDA announced the first recipients of its Commissioner's National Priority Voucher (CNPV) pilot program, and daraxonrasib was among them. The voucher allows the sponsor to receive an expedited 1–2 month review once the marketing application is submitted.
This was a further important regulatory endorsement for daraxonrasib following Breakthrough Therapy Designation, reflecting the agency's focus on pancreatic cancer as an area of very high unmet medical need.
